Brogue

Visit

A classic ASCII roguelike that emphasizes deep mechanics and accessibility. It offers fully procedural dungeon generation, strategic depth through complex item interactions, and a unique 'one action per turn' system that allows for thoughtful, methodical gameplay without requiring fast reflexes.

Crypt of the NecroDancer

Visit

A rhythm-based roguelike where all actions must be performed on beat. Its procedural generation of dungeon layouts and enemy placements, combined with its unique musical gameplay loop, creates a highly engaging and challenging experience that rewards precision and timing in every run.

FTL: Faster Than Light

Visit

This spaceship simulation roguelike tasks players with managing a crew and ship systems while navigating procedurally generated sectors. Strategic decision-making is key, as players must adapt to random events, enemy fleets, and resource scarcity, offering deep replayability through varied ship configurations.
